webapps container should not automatically restore
Bug #1372243 reported by
Bill Filler
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
The Webapps-core project |
Fix Released
|
Critical
|
Alexandre Abreu | ||
webbrowser-app (Ubuntu) |
Fix Released
|
Critical
|
Alexandre Abreu |
Bug Description
Making this it's own bug for tracking purposes.
Currently the webapps container will attempt to restore the last open page whenever it is restarted. This is causing issues on some sites that do redirection causing a blank white screen on restore.
The proposed solution is to only restore when the app is killed by oom killer and not in the use case where the user closes the app.
Related branches
lp:~abreu-alexandre/webbrowser-app/remove-session-storage
- PS Jenkins bot: Needs Fixing (continuous-integration)
- Olivier Tilloy: Approve
- David Barth (community): Approve
-
Diff: 195 lines (+14/-71)7 files modifiedsrc/app/BrowserView.qml (+0/-1)
src/app/browserapplication.cpp (+0/-1)
src/app/webbrowser/Browser.qml (+2/-0)
src/app/webbrowser/webbrowser-app.cpp (+1/-0)
src/app/webcontainer/WebApp.qml (+10/-64)
src/app/webcontainer/webapp-container.cpp (+0/-2)
src/app/webcontainer/webapp-container.qml (+1/-3)
Changed in webapps-core: | |
importance: | Undecided → Critical |
status: | New → In Progress |
assignee: | nobody → Alexandre Abreu (abreu-alexandre) |
tags: | added: rtm14 touch-2014-09-25 |
Changed in webapps-core: | |
status: | In Progress → Fix Released |
Changed in webbrowser-app (Ubuntu): | |
importance: | Undecided → Critical |
assignee: | nobody → Alexandre Abreu (abreu-alexandre) |
To post a comment you must log in.
This bug was fixed in the package webbrowser-app - 0.23+14. 10.20140926- 0ubuntu1
--------------- 10.20140926- 0ubuntu1) utopic; urgency=low
webbrowser-app (0.23+14.
[ Sebastien Bacher ]
* Let the refresh button adapt to the label it contains (LP: #1366024)
[ Michał Sawicz ]
* Make missing intltool a fatal configuration error.
[ Akiva Avraham ]
* Update imports of Ubuntu.Unity.Action to 1.1.
[ Alexandre Abreu ]
* Remove session storage for the webapp container. (LP: #1372243)
* Fix UriHandler url opening operation for the webapp container. (LP:
#1371731)
[ Michael Sheldon ]
* Ensure that the url of the page we're loading is displayed, instead
of the currently loaded url. (LP: #1354388)
[ CI bot ]
* Resync trunk
[ Ugo Riboni ]
* Fix add tab label to be readable in most localizations. (LP:
#1364376)
-- Ubuntu daily release <email address hidden> Fri, 26 Sep 2014 06:13:37 +0000